The area of spacetime which may be noticed is the backward light cone, which delimits the cosmological horizon. The cosmological horizon, also referred to as the particle horizon or the light horizon, is the most length from which particles might have traveled into the observer from the age on the universe. This horizon represents the boundary involving the observable as well as unobservable areas of your universe.[81][82]

This method, known as Large Bang nucleosynthesis, lasted for around 17 minutes and finished about twenty minutes once the Large Bang, so only the fastest and easiest reactions transpired. About 25% of your protons and many of the neutrons from the universe, by mass, have been converted to helium, with smaller amounts of deuterium (a form of hydrogen) and traces of lithium.

The Sunlight can be a dynamic and sophisticated star that performs a significant role in our everyday lives. It’s a massive, amazingly very hot ball of gasoline that’s been burning shiny for billions of decades. And it'll go on to melt away for billions much more. With no Sunshine, life as we understand it basically wouldn’t exist.
Nor will it very last endlessly in its present-day state. Numerous billion a long time from now, the Sunlight will broaden, swallowing Mercury and Venus, and filling Earth’s sky. It might even extend significant plenty of to swallow Earth by itself. It’s tricky to be certain. After all, individuals have only just begun deciphering the cosmos.
